### Per-tenant rate quotas

Every tenant on Meadowgate gets a baseline quota of requests per minute, enforced at the gateway before traffic reaches services. Quotas are tiered by plan and can be temporarily raised during a migration window — coordinate with the platform team before any release that changes traffic patterns. Current quota tiers, override procedures, and the approval workflow are documented on the internal quota page.

operations page: https://jenkins.zemvarcloud.local/job/merge_requests/repo/build/73930b4b30f0a8ed

## Blue-Green Deploys: Ledgerline Billing Worker

Plugin authors: your hooks must be side-effect free during the green warmup phase. Ledgerline runs both colors for five minutes while invoice jobs drain from blue. If your plugin writes to external stores, gate writes behind the `active_color` flag or duplicates will post. Cutover is automatic once queue depth on blue reaches zero. After cutover, verify your plugin against the token stamped on the green release below.

build token for yajof-bajof: htk31_506ff1188f74596b5bb2eec94edc43c

# ScanBridge settings — barcode scanner integration
#
# Support note: these values control how scans from Wexler handheld
# units are matched against the product catalog. If agents report
# "unknown barcode" errors, check the symbology list before touching
# anything else — EAN-13 must stay enabled. Scan events are logged
# and reconciled nightly against the catalog database, which the
# service reaches using the connection string below.

replica DSN, kajep-yahag: mssql://praok_svc:iF@db-8d68.plorvaio.local:5432/eliion

Subject: On-call basics for GridWeave

Welcome aboard. You're now on the rotation for GridWeave, our crossword generator service. Most pages are about puzzle batches failing validation overnight. Restart the solver pool first; that clears nine out of ten incidents. Escalation steps and past incident notes live on the internal wiki page here:

wiki page, tahaf-tajog: https://jira.ordindyn.corp/pipeline